Output 0876e77613f82640a92dcdc2ab26150d3a1aeaaa3fe3c88a2397eb12b3170237:3

value
2834413
script pubkey
OP_0 OP_PUSHBYTES_20 da4ab9b6895510e39299b17c3b559008e1ebb67d
address
bc1qmf9tnd5f25gw8y5ek97rk4vsprs7hdnarzvcw8
transaction
0876e77613f82640a92dcdc2ab26150d3a1aeaaa3fe3c88a2397eb12b3170237
spent
true